10 yrs of jail for one, acquittal for another in sexual assault case

From Our Correspondent

NONGSTOIN, Aug 23: A special court in West Khasi Hills found one Sheldar Syiemlieh guilty in the case of sexual assault of a minor girl, while exonerating the second accused, Richard Kharbani, of the charges.
On appreciation of all evidences uncovered in the investigation, the Court of Special Judge (POCSO), Nongstoin, sentenced Syiemlieh to 10 years of rigorous imprisonment with fine of Rs 20,000.
Earlier, an FIR in connection with the case had mentioned that the minor was sexually assaulted by Richard Kharbani and Sheldar Syiemlieh, according to a statement.
